    No co-sponsors. I forgot who, but it's been mentioned here that bills without co-sponsors die every time. Let's hope this does too.



    Taken from [url]http://www.thepetitionsite.com/1/lets-stop-bill-hr-45[/URL]



    This is a synopsis:

    • You will have to carry a photo ID firearms license.
    • A training class is required to be licensed.
    • Disclosure of your storage method is required for license.
    • A thumb print is required for license.
    • Every sale recorded by the federal government.
    • If you move, and don't tell the Attorney General within 60 days, you are a criminal.
    • If a firearm is stolen and you don't report it, you are a criminal.
    • There will be no grandfathered firearms.
    • If you do not obtain a license and report every firearm you currently own, you are a criminal.
    • There will be a license fee and a fee for the "services" provided at purchase time.
    • Licenses must be renewed every 5 years.
    The Bill, H.R. 45, is dated 6 January, 2009, and the liberals are already on the move.

    That's an internet legend. There is a pending HR 45 to regulate firearms but it is in committee and has had no action and looks to have no action ever taken on it. The text in the OP above is the internet legend that is not true. That has been floating around since 2000 or so and I've gotten the same email. Always check with the TSRA and NRA for the status of pending leglislation.

    Let's let the hysteria die down. I'm enjoying having ammo available again.
